5 Sweet Acts Of Kindness For Kids To Develop Social-Emotional Skills

Every person wants to make the world a better place. And for people who are parents, raising kind kids is one of their most important parenting goals. But to develop kindness in kids, parents need to make an effort and teach it to them.

You need to intentionally raise your kid to be kind, and make them practice kind behavior daily. Studies show that kindness can make your kid happier, reduce stress, and improve their self-esteem. Practicing kind actions activates the joyful area of the brain and boosts the well-being of your kid. Moreover, modeling kind behavior in your kids is essential to develop their social-emotional skills.

Evidence also shows that many kids are inclined to be helpful and compassionate. But additionally, parents can try out some things to both teach and reinforce this behavior. Read on to find out more!

5 Sweet Acts Of Kindness For Kids To Develop Social-Emotional Skills


Below are some acts that your kids can practice to show love, empathy, concern, and friendliness to others without any selfish reasons-


1. Taking Your Kids To an NGO


You can consider taking your kid to an NGO to enhance their social-emotional skills. Upon visiting an NGO, they will see people who do not possess the same luxuries as them. You can also encourage them to show their compassion and concern for the children at the NGO by sharing their food or toys with them.


2. Take Them To Orphanage


You can also try taking your kid to the local orphanage. When they see children without parents, they will try to be loving and empathetic towards them. Your kid can also donate their clothes to them. It will develop a sense of self-fulfillment in them. They will feel proud of themselves because they helped the needy. 


3. Feeding Street Animals


You can also let your kid feed street animals. This is a very kind gesture towards animals as most street animals die because of food scarcity. You can make your child learn to feed dogs, cows, monkeys, etc. This will develop their social skills like showing concern to animals, being considerate to their condition, etc. 


4. Planting Trees


Caring for the environment is another method to show kindness. Planting a tree helps the environment, but nurturing a plant could teach your kid patience and affection. This also develops a connection between your kid and their surroundings.


5. Visit Specially Abled People


How about taking your kid to Specially Abled People? When they see differently-abled people, they will feel gratitude towards their life and appreciate it in its present form. Letting your kid visit Specially-abled people will also develop a loving and helping attitude towards everyone.
